Phonak Roger Touchscreen Mic teacher microphone

How to recognise it: A handheld teacher microphone with a colour touchscreen and a physical mute button on the side.

Start here

Three safe first checks

Try these in order. If something looks damaged, unusually hot or unsafe, stop and request service.

  1. 1

    Charge first

    Place the microphone in its approved charger and allow it to charge before troubleshooting a connection problem.

  2. 2

    Check mute

    Confirm that the microphone is switched on and not muted. Look at the screen and status indicator before changing settings.

  3. 3

    Keep equipment together

    Have the microphone, receivers or hearing devices and any charging dock beside you before opening a guide.

Something isn’t working

Work through one symptom

Do not change several settings at once. After each check, test the same simple speech task again.

There is no sound

Check that the microphone is powered on and unmuted, that the listener’s device is working normally, and that the Roger device is shown as connected. If the system worked before, note exactly what changed before reconnecting or resetting anything.

A receiver or hearing device is not connected

Bring the devices together and use Phonak’s official connection instructions for the exact receiver or RogerDirect hearing device. Do not remove an existing network unless you know every device that must be reconnected.

The microphone will not charge

Check that the approved power supply is firmly connected, reseat the microphone in the dock or cable, and inspect the charging contacts for visible obstruction. Stop if the device or charger becomes unusually hot or appears damaged.
